The New York State Primary date for federal elections (U.S. Congress and Senate) has been set for Tuesday, June 26th. Petitioning is set to begin on Tuesday, March 20th. While a date has not been finalized for state offices (Assembly, Senate, State Committee), it is possible that the primaries for those offices will also be held on June 26th, with a similar petitioning schedule.

‘Most Highly Qualified’ Supreme Court candidates

The Supreme Court Independent Screening Panel has reported out and the candidates have been invited to our general meeting- Monday, September 19th at 8:00pm for a brief introduction and question period by the audience.

In addition to Judges Deborah Kaplan, Saliann Scarpulla, Manuel Mendez and Ellen Gesmer who were reported out twice from previous Independent Screening Panels and are thus eligible for consideration,  the following nine judges were deemed  ‘Most Highly Qualified’ to be Supreme Court candidates:

Arthur Engoron, Shlomo Hagler, Barbara Jaffe, Rita Mella, Peter Moulton, Ruth Pickholz, George Silver, Anil Singh, and Analisa Torres.
